LampPro Tip 1/3

Emotional Weight

When 'perturb' is used, it suggests a mild to moderate level of disturbance, not an extreme one.

Illustration for Emotional Weight
He was perturbed by the constant buzzing but managed to focus.
LampPro Tip 2/3

Temporary Effect

'Perturb' usually implies a temporary bother or disturbance, not a lasting problem.

Illustration for Temporary Effect
The flashing lights briefly perturbed her, then she ignored them.
LampPro Tip 3/3

Neutral to Negative

The connotation of 'perturb' is neutral to negative; it's seldom positive.

Illustration for Neutral to Negative
His indifferent attitude perturbed his concerned mother.
